#2c1017 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c1017 is composed of 17.3% red, 6.3%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.6% magenta, 47.7%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 345 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 11.8%. #2c1017 color hex could be obtained by blending #58202e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#2c1017 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c1017 has RGB values of R:44, G:16,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.48, K:0.83. Its decimal value is 2887703.
